Clinical Study Ventricle Shape in Twin
Schizophrenia Study
  • Twin Pairs
  • Monozygotic (MZ) Identical twins
  • Dizygotic (DZ) Nonidentical twins
  • MZ-Discordant (MZ-DS) for Schizophrenia
    Identical twins affected at risk pairs
  • Nonrelated (NR) age/gender matched
  • Focus on ventricle size and shape
  • Data D. Weinberger, NIMH

Clinical Study Statistical Analysis of
Structures
  • Types of Analysis
  • Pairwise co-twin similarity (are MZ pairs more
    similar than DZ)
  • Group differences Healthy versus Disease
  • Volume or Shape

Group Tests
  • Healthy ventricle template
  • Both subgroups of the MZ discordant twins
    (affected and at risk) compared to healthy
  • Questions
  • Effect of schizophrenia on ventricles?
  • At risk subject?

Healthy All
15
Group Tests of Ventricular Volumes
All tests nonsignificant SZ do not show
ventricle volume difference
16
Group Tests Shape Distance to Healthy
Co-twin at risk, healthy
Co-twin schizophr.
Healthy All
  • Both subgroups of MZ discordant for SZ (affected
    and at risk) differ.
  • Ventricular shape seems to be marker for disease/
    vulnerability (?)
  • Shape is much better marker than volume
